Megasporogenesis and Development of Female Gametophyte of Endangered Species Populus pruinosa

2011 
The megasporogenesis and development of female gametophyte of endangered species Populus pruinosa Schrenk.were studied using method of paraffin section.The results indicated that the pistil of P.pruinosa was composed of three carpels,parietal placenta,with 18 to 21 rows of anatropous ovule.At the early developmental stage,the ovule showed crassinnucellate and bitegminous,the inner integument degenerated when the outer integument developed into the same level with inner integument,the mature ovule was unitegmic.One archesporial cell differentiated from two layers beneath the epidermises.The megaspore mother cell directly developed from the archesportial cell which formed after the archesporial cell division.The megaspore mother cell undergoes meiosis to form a linear tetrad,the chalazal megaspore functions,polygonum-type embryo.During the developing of embryo,nucellus tissue of micropylar end degradated.According to the flower morphological character of flowering phenology at different growing stage,it is possible to estimate primarily the process of megasporogenesis and development of female gametophyte of P.pruinosa.
